Effectiveness of the contemporary treatment of preterm labor: a comparison with a historical cohort.

Philipp WagnerJiri SonekHarald AbeleLoefler SarahMarkus HoopmannSara BruckerQinging WuKarl Oliver Kagan
Published in: Archives of gynecology and obstetrics (2017)
Short-term hospitalization and tocolysis followed by vaginal progesterone for maintenance tocolysis is more effective than a protocol which includes long-term hospital stay, beta-mimetics, antibiotics, and bed rest.
